After a couple of months of excitement and prep on Sunday June 21st we were finally ready to embark on our trip - getting up bright and early for the drive down to Ashford. Alas I havent any pictures of the first day, I'm sure you all understand! (there are pics coming but we didn't get the camera out on first day)
I made up a CD the night before to listen to in the car full of disney tracks which I thought suited the journey and listened to that the whole way - we also picked up DUncle on the way.

I have to say I love how simple the Eurostar process is - I'm used to the airports and going all over the place for check in and all that so its a nice change to just walk through and do the baggage and passport check within minutes to get a sitdown. We also did Disney Express again. The train was another story though! it was very full that morning and there seemed to be a bit of an issue with seating as we had been split up for some reason, some guy had it even worse - he was sat quite a few rows away from his wife and kids! Very strange. We were also sat backwards which seemed to make us all a tad green around the gills. Thankfully we were in the upgrade seats on the way back! We were all quite glad to be off the train and got Disney Express sorted and finished off some reservations. Once we did that we decided it was off to Studios!

We made a direct beeline for Animagique as we all remembered enjoying that a lot the last time we went. I'm sure they have added to the show since 2005 as it was even more amazing this time around. We also did Cinemagique which is fun though a little plain. Studios looks a LOT better since they added the Tower of Terror area - makes it look a little less plain. The crowds were pretty good the first day too - it gradually ramped up during our trip but Studios wasnt too busy and Donald was messing about on a Studio Kart with his minder which was fun to see - also interesting to see HSM Mickey and Minnie.

After that we made our way to Sequoia Lodge to get our room. I have to say we all fell in love with Sequoia almost at first sight! We love serene nature areas and Sequoia just fit the bill. I can see why it wouldnt suit kids so much though. We stayed in Yellowstone Lodge and we had adjoining rooms with DUncle. We were surprised to find we had doors between us that we could open. Which was nice as we only had to knock to inform each other of plans. I also informed parents to rent a kettle

DM's bad back was bothering her so she and DF took a break while me and DUncle went for a stroll as he wanted to see Santa Fe and we were looking for a way to get sugar and milks as we forgot to bring those. I have to say I can see why people love the Cheyenne - we walked through it and the western theming was impeccable - no wonder kids love it. We moved on and had a quick peek in Hotel New York which looks AMAZING on the inside. Got a coffee there and pinched a few sugar packs and made our way back

We had a reservation for Steakhouse at 7:30pm so returned to rooms and had a few mins to get ready - DM was still feeling a bit off but decided she wanted to come along regardless. We had the half board menu and me and DF had the Cappachino Carrot Soup and DUncle and DM had the Ocean City Casserole - the Carrot soup was really nice and I loved the muffin - DM and DUncle seemed to think the Casserole nice but a bit strong for a starter. Sadly DM had to bow out the meal because the meds she took for her back made her very sleepy so she went back to the room - the server was kind enough to not take her half board voucher nor charge us for her meal. I had the rump steak for main (So Good!) and DUncle and DF had the Chicken Curry which by all accounts was very nice. Me and DF finished off with the delish Baileys Creme Brulee and DUncle had the scoops of Cherry Garcia.

We then spent an hour looking through the shops in the Village giving DM some time to rest so we wouldnt wake her up. After all that we went back to the room and checked on DM before going to bed and decided next day we would get her a wheelchair to take some pressure off her back.
